js按字符截取字符串方法
在JavaScript中,可以使用字符串的`slice(`方法、`substr(`方法和`substring(`方法来按字符截取字符串。
1. `slice(start, end)`:指定截取的起始位置和结束位置。起始位置为字符串中的起始字符的索引,结束位置为字符串中的结束字符的索引加一(不包括结束字符本身)。
```javascript
var str = "Hello World!";
var slicedStr = str.slice(6, 11); // "World"substring和slice
```
2. `substr(start, length)`:指定截取的起始位置和截取的字符数。起始位置为字符串中的起始字符的索引,截取的字符数为需要截取的字符数量。
```javascript
var str = "Hello World!";
var substrStr = str.substr(6, 5); // "World"
```
3. `substring(start, end)`:与`slice(`方法类似,也是指定截取的起始位置和结束位置,但不同的是,起始位置和结束位置的顺序无所谓,会自动调整为合理的顺序。
```javascript
var str = "Hello World!";
var substringStr = str.substring(6, 11); // "World"
```
这些方法都返回从原始字符串中截取的子字符串。注意,这些方法不会改变原始字符串本身。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。